S36 1JP maps, stats, and open data

S36 1JP lies on Paterson Croft in Stocksbridge, Sheffield. S36 1JP is located in the Stocksbridge and Upper Don electoral ward, within the metropolitan district of Sheffield and the English Parliamentary constituency of Penistone and Stocksbridge.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S South Yorkshire ICB - 03N and the police force is South Yorkshire. This postcode has been in use since June 1997.
